
Illini Swim Shatters Three School Records on Day Two of Boilermaker Invite

WEST LAFAYETTE, Ind. – The Fighting Illini swim and dive team wrapped up day two of competition at the Boilermaker Invite on Friday, Nov. 17. The Illini currently sit in third place with 377 points. Junior Sydney Stoll won the 100 butterfly finals with a brand new school record, 54.24.
BETWEEN THE LANES
The 200 medley relay team of junior Suvana Baskar, freshman Kylee Sessions, junior Logan Kuehne and senior Lily Olson began Friday night's finals by shattering the program record and earning second place (1:39.37).
Baskar broke her own school record 100 backstroke in the finals tonight; she placed second with her new program record time of 53.66. She was also the 200 medley relay lead off tonight and moved up to second on the school's 50 backstroke leaderboard (25.02).
Kuehne moved into the program's 100 butterfly top-10 list; she's now ninth in school history with a time of 55.39 that placed her seventh in the finals tonight.
A plethora of other Illini recorded more personal-bests from day two action. Freshman Kalina Nikolaeva placed 11th in the 400 IM finals with a new best time (4:24.27). In the 100 butterfly three Illini left the pool with new best marks: junior Jane Umhofer (57.31), Baskar (57.59) and freshman Marin McAndrew (58.28). Freshman Martina Cibulkova (1:51.27) and senior Laurel Bludgen (1:51.68) clocked new bests in the 200 freestyle.
ON THE BOARDS
Junior Taylor Michael led the Orange and Blue divers on the one-meter boards. She placed 10th in the finals with a score of 246.45. Freshman Elleka Boeres scored 234.15 points and placed 11th in tonight's finals right behind Michael.
